The first public library opened April 9, 1833, in Peterborough, New Hampshire. Of the estimated 122,566 U.S. libraries, more than 9,000 are Public Libraries; and some 99,000 are School Libraries.
Most Public Libraries (85%) are connected to some form of local government.
